Squid Posted June 18, 2017 Share Posted June 18, 2017 It keeps trying and failing to mount the docker.img. Settings - Docker - Disable Docker Service Reboot Settings - Docker - Advanced - Delete the docker.img file Settings - Docker - Enable Docker Service Re-add your apps via Apps tab (Previous Apps section) or Docker Tab Add Container, Template Dropdown, my* user templates Link to comment

Squid Posted June 19, 2017 Share Posted June 19, 2017 If you're having problems with Plex, change the Appdata config path from /mnt/user/... to be /mnt/cache/... Also, edit your Media host path and set it to be RW:Slave for best results Link to comment
